# Creates a formatted summary of a collection of episodes.
#
module EpisodeSummary
module_function
# Converts the passed episode items in a summary
# that is formatted based on the passed format.
# @param [Array<#title>] items The episodes to summarize
# @param [Symbol] format The summary format (:html and :json
# supported)
# @return [String]
def process(items, format=:html)
if format == :html
output = html_header + "\n"
output += sorted_summaries(items, :show_name, :title).join("\n")
output += html_footer
output
elsif format == :json
items.map(&:to_json)
else
"Format #{format} not supported"
end
end
def sorted_summaries(items, by_attribute, fallback=nil)
fallback_value = ->(item){ fallback ? item.send(fallback).to_s : 'zzzzzzzz' }
sorted = items.sort do |a,b|
(a.show_name || fallback_value.call(a)) <=> (b.show_name || fallback_value.call(b))
end
sorted.map{|i| html_episode_summary(i) }
end
def html_header
<<-EOS
<!DOCTYPE html>
<html>
<head><meta charset="utf-8"></head>
<body>
<div>
<h1>List of episodes</h1>
<ul>
EOS
end
def html_footer
"</ul></div></body></html>"
end
def html_episode_summary(item)
<<-EOS
<li>
<h2>#{item.show_name} - #{item.title}</h2>
#{("<div><img href='#{item.url}'
src='" + item.image_url +
"' /img></div>") if item.image_url}
<a href="#{item.url}">
#{(item.notes.nil? || item.notes == "") ? 'link' : item.notes }
</a>
#{("<span> Show ref: " + item.show_ref + "</span>") if item.show_ref}
</li>
EOS
end
end
